Great views on the way up out of Cherry. Is that a sweet picnic spot or what ! Look at the view from the top. This has to be one of the top 10 picnic tables in the state !
If you go up to the next level ~ 500 feet higher you get to the Hang-Glider launch ramp ! Yes, they jump from the highest level of Mingus Mountain ! NOT THIS BOY! ,,,, I’ll pass on this one !
Glenn and Jim are standing in front of the small cement pad. The other side is the Ramp you run down off the side of the mountain. You better be committed there is no turning back!
